This Is How You Build Lasagna-Inspired Soup
Melt butter and olive oil in a large soup pot over medium heat. Gently sauté onions until they turn soft and translucent, releasing their sweet aroma.
Sprinkle flour into the pot and stir for a minute to build a rich base. Slowly pour in chicken broth, whisking until smooth. Let the mixture simmer and thicken slightly.
Add shredded chicken and broken lasagna noodles to the simmering broth. Allow the noodles to dance and soften until they reach perfect tenderness.
Reduce heat and pour in half-and-half. Sprinkle mozzarella and Parmesan, stirring until the cheese melts into a luxurious, velvety blanket. Season with salt and pepper to your liking.
Toss in fresh spinach and watch it gently wilt into the soup, adding a pop of color and nutrition.
Ladle the soup into bowls. Crown each serving with a dollop of ricotta, a sprinkle of herbs, or extra cheese for a personal touch.

Comforting White Lasagna Soup Recipe
- Total Time: 40 minutes
- Yield: 7 1x
Description
Creamy white lasagna soup brings hearty Italian comfort to your dinner table, blending rich cheese and tender pasta in a velvety broth. Warm, satisfying flavors invite you to savor each spoonful of this comforting culinary experience.
Ingredients
- 5 cups low-sodium chicken broth
- 2 cups cooked shredded chicken (rotisserie)
- 8 oz lasagna noodles (broken into pieces)
- 1 ½ cups half-and-half or heavy cream
- 1 ½ cups mozzarella cheese (shredded)
- 2 tbsps butter
- 1 tbsp olive oil
- 1 medium yellow onion (diced)
- 3 cloves garlic (minced)
- 2 ½ cups baby spinach
- ½ cup Parmesan cheese (grated)
- 2 tbsps all-purpose flour
- 1 tsp Italian seasoning
- ½ tsp crushed red pepper flakes (optional)
- ¼ tsp ground nutmeg
- Salt and pepper (to taste)
- Ricotta cheese (optional)
- Fresh basil or extra Parmesan (optional)
Instructions
- Aromatic Foundation: Heat butter and olive oil in a large soup pot over medium flame. Caramelize onions until translucent, then introduce garlic, Italian seasoning, red pepper flakes, and nutmeg, releasing their vibrant essences.
- Roux Development: Dust flour into the aromatic mixture, stirring continuously to create a smooth base. Gradually incorporate chicken broth, allowing the liquid to simmer and thicken, developing a rich, velvety consistency.
- Protein and Pasta Integration: Fold shredded chicken and fractured lasagna noodles into the simmering liquid. Allow the pasta to cook until perfectly tender, absorbing the layered flavors of the broth.
- Creamy Cheese Transformation: Reduce heat and introduce half-and-half, mozzarella, and Parmesan, creating a luxurious, molten texture. Season with salt and pepper to elevate the overall taste profile.
- Verdant Finale: Gently wilt spinach into the soup, adding a fresh, nutritious element. Transfer the aromatic creation into serving vessels, garnishing with a creamy ricotta dollop, additional cheese, or fragrant herbs for a sophisticated presentation.
Notes
- Whisk flour slowly and continuously when creating the roux to avoid clumpy texture and ensure smooth soup consistency.
- Break lasagna noodles into smaller pieces to help them cook evenly and make the soup easier to eat with a spoon.
- Lower heat when adding dairy to prevent curdling and maintain a silky, creamy soup texture.
- Add salt and pepper incrementally, tasting as you go to balance flavors without over-seasoning the delicate white lasagna soup.
